Transaction 389904cc14511a079aa9c2a430ce5e9ee1edb2775e5fe50b26e68533b2874bb8
1 Input
1 Output
-
389904cc14511a079aa9c2a430ce5e9ee1edb2775e5fe50b26e68533b2874bb8:0
- value
- 1099949
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 474d50d62773a35d6ba611b9b414fdc8ba068458 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17W1bcbRBP92nBFQUAZRgRiXNDX8SSP2FX